Registration
of
Small Farmers
As stipulated by the SFWF’s Act No .12 of 2002,
(i) Section 2 – A small farmer is defined as a small planter, small breeder or small agro – processor or a group of small planters, breeders or agro-processors registered with the Fund
(ii) Section 16 – Contributions to Fund
For the purposes of this Act, a small planter who wishes to benefit from any scheme set up under section 4 (2)(b) or facilities granted by the Government shall, except for a cane planter , be –
- Registered with the Fund
- Subscribed to a Farmer’s protection Scheme
The Registration of Farmers therefore allows the extension of facilities to eligible bonafide farmers in a structured and efficient manner.
Following the registration exercise
(i) A Farmer’s Card is issued to each registered farmer
(ii) A Farmers Central Database was established to store all data collected during the registration exercise mainly on the economical and social profile of farming community.
The FCD assisted the Fund much in implementing relevant schemes for the welfare of the farming community. The FCD was also made to other Government institutions (agricultural as well as non agricultural) to conduct various activities for the progress of the agricultural sector.
Planter
- National Identity Card (Original and a photocopy)
- Two recent passport-sized photographs*
- Previous Small Farmers Card (if any) AND
- LAND TENURE DOCUMENTS
EITHER
- A copy of the relevant title deed or a registered Lease Agreement or a non-registered Lease Agreement plus copy of title deed of land owner
OR- A copy of SIFB Card in case of sugarcane planter
OR- Original letter from the Secretary of the Cooperative authorizing the planter to use its land and
- A copy of the title deed / lease contract of the said land to the order of the said Cooperative for the land under crop production, as would be declared at time of registration
- Utility bill (copy)
Breeder
- National Identity Card (Original and a photocopy)
- Two recent passport-sized photographs*
- Previous Small Farmers Card (if any) AND
- LAND TENURE DOCUMENTS
EITHER
- A copy of the land’s title deed or a registered Lease Agreement or a non-registered Lease Agreement plus copy of title deed of land owner
OR- Original letter from the Secretary of the Cooperative authorizing the planter to use its land and
- A copy of the title deed / lease contract of the said land to the order of the said Cooperative for the land under crop production, as would be declared at time of registration AND
- Site plan of farm including size
- Tag number of each animal
- The Division of Veterinary Services (DVS) Animal Card (where applicable)
- Building permit (where applicable)
- Utility bill (copy)
Agro-Processing Enterprise
- Business Registration Card
- Certificate of Incorporation (Where applicable)
- List of Directors and associates(Previous Small Farmers Card (if any) and land tenure documents)
- Copy of minutes of proceedings authorizing a director / directors to represent the group of agro-processors and identity cards of all shareholders (Previous Small Farmers Card (if any) and land tenure documents)
- Valid Certificate from SMEDA
- Site Plan
Group of Planters (Cooperatives, Association, Society/Company
- Certificate of Incorporation or valid Certificate from SMEDA
- List of Directors and associates of the Cooperative, Association, Société / Company
- Copy of minutes of proceedings authorizing one of the directors / associates to undertake the administrative tasks of the said Cooperative, Association, Société / Company
- A copy of the National ID Card of the representative of the said Cooperative, Association, Société / Company
- Land tenure documents
* Small farmers who were registered for period 2017-2018 are not required to submit their photograph unless they want to provide a recent one.
Contribution:
A registration fee of Rs 650 representing membership fees for the two years period is payable.
